A survey of electrical utility worker body impedance was conducted using a contact-current meter. Measurements of body pathway impedance for all hand and foot combinations were made on 191 male and 40 female Southern California Edison employees. ESD protection devices are placed on circuit boards to protect integrated circuits from ESD stress to systems. There are no generally accepted standards for characterizing the ESD performance of such devices. This article will make recommendations for the proper procedures for characterizing off chip ESD protection devices.
